Detailed Description:
The TowerPro MG996R is a staple in the hobby and robotics community, representing a significant upgrade from its well-known predecessor, the MG995. This metal gear servo motor is engineered for high-stress applications, offering exceptional durability and resistance to wear thanks to its full metal gearing. Its core strength lies in its impressive performance metrics, including a high stall torque of 11 kg·cm at 6V and a very respectable 9.4 kg·cm at 4.8V. This powerful force allows it to effortlessly handle heavier loads, making it a perfect actuator for everything from robotic arms and hexapods to steering systems in RC cars and larger aircraft.
Beyond its strength, the MG996R features a redesigned PCB and improved IC control system, which work together to enhance its accuracy and centering. It has an operating speed of 0.17 sec/60° at 4.8V and a faster 0.14 sec/60° at 6V, providing a responsive and dynamic performance for a wide range of tasks. With a classic 180° rotation angle, it is easily controlled by a standard PWM signal, making it highly compatible with popular microcontrollers like Arduino and Raspberry Pi. Its low cost and robust build have solidified the MG996R's reputation as a reliable and effective high torque servo motor, suitable for both beginners and experienced builders seeking a dependable and powerful solution for their projects.

Technical Specifications:
Parameter |
Specification |
Operating Voltage |
4.8V – 6.0V DC |
Stall Torque |
9.4 kg·cm (4.8V), 11–12 kg·cm (6V) |
Operating Speed |
0.19 sec/60° (4.8V), 0.14 sec/60° (6V) |
Rotation Angle |
180° ±10° |
Gear Type |
Full Metal Gear |
Control Signal |
PWM (50Hz – standard) |
Dimensions |
40.7mm × 19.7mm × 42.9mm |
Weight |
~55g |
Connector Type |
3-pin (GND, VCC, Signal – compatible with Futaba/JR) |
How to Use with Arduino:
-
Connect VCC to 5V, GND to GND, and Signal to PWM pin (e.g., D9)
-
Include Servo.h
library
-
Use PWM to position the servo (0° to 180°)
